Ahmed M Soliman, MD

According to 2025 Medicare claims, Ahmed Soliman, MD (NPI: 1598753667) practices otolaryngology in the Philadelphia, PA market, with the plurality of this provider's patient population coming from Philadelphia, PA. This provider's primary affiliated billing organization is TEMPLE FACULTY PRACTICE PLAN, INC (NPI: 1023591781; TIN: 831002191) and primary practice location at 19140-5103.

Soliman's data goes back to 2015 and runs through 2024. For example, in 2024, this provider had 377 traditional Medicare patients, billed 1,887 HCPCS/CPT codes, and received $111,803 in Medicare payments. The top billing code was 31579 (Exam to assess movement of vocal cord flaps using an endoscope). Part D data shows 839 prescription claims across 255 beneficiaries totaling $20,819 in drug costs, led by Famotidine (Famotidine). 2023 DME data shows 18 claims. No Open Payments records.
